The Savory Side: Hits and Misses

When it comes to the food menu, certain items receive consistent and enthusiastic praise. The birria queso tacos are frequently described as "phenomenal," earning a reputation as a must-try dish for first-time visitors. Accompanied by a rich consommé for dipping, these tacos showcase the kitchen's ability to produce deeply flavorful and satisfying Mexican cuisine. Similarly, customers have pointed out the high quality of the tortillas, calling them "spectacular," a detail that elevates simple dishes. Other popular savory items include Sonoran hot dogs, carne asada fries, and various tortas, which cater to those seeking a substantial meal. These dishes are noted for their generous portions and authentic taste profiles.

The Sweet and Refreshing: The "Fruti" in Frutilandia

True to its name, Frutilandia excels in its offerings of fruit-based desserts, beverages, and snacks. This is the core of its identity as a premier smoothie bar and dessert destination. The menu features a vast selection of traditional Mexican treats, including raspados (shaved ice with natural fruit syrups), mangonadas (a sweet and spicy mango slushy), and fresas con crema (strawberries and cream). These items are celebrated for their authenticity and use of fresh ingredients, providing a genuine taste of Latin desserts.
